Key Areas of Study
The 8-Week Certification Program
Six weeks of classroom instruction followed by two weeks of supervised practice at an
active Swap & Glow™ station. No prior electrical experience required.
Module 1 – Weeks 1-2 : Clean Energy & E-Mobility
-> Solar PV fundamentals for the Sahel
-> The electric mobility transition in WestAfrica
-> How SIRA™ battery chemistry works
-> Environmental impact and carbon basics
Module 02 – Weeks 3-4 : Technical Operations
-> Solar array inspection and maintenance
-> DMS swappable battery system procedures
-> BMS safety and fault diagnosis
-> loT monitoring dashboard basics
Module 03 – Week 5: Business & Digital Skills
-> Financial literacy and daily reconciliation
-> Mobile money systems (Orange Money,Wave)
-> Station record-keeping and reporting
-> Basic site maintenance scheduling
Module 04 – Week 6: Leadership & Community Service
-> Customer service excellence
-> Conflict resolution and de-escalation
-> Community trust-building strategies
-> The Yennenga Warrior ethos

Frequently asked questions
At the Ba-Suka Academy, we believe the clean-energy transition is only as strong as the leaders who operate it.
Any motivated woman based in Burkina Faso who is interested in technology, sustainability, and
community service. No prior experience in electrical engineering is required – we train from the
ground up.
Is there a cost to Participate ?
Training costs are currently covered by Ba-Suka Energy. Further details on stipend and living
support will be confirmed at the application stage.
Does Graduation Guarantee Employment ?
Our goal is to assign every certified graduate to a station. Placement depends on station availability
in your region, but all graduates enter our priority talent pool for new launches and supervisory roles.
